The Global Cone Crusher Market is projected to expand from USD 3.24 Billion in 2025 to USD 4.51 Billion by 2031, registering a CAGR of 5.67%. These compression machines are essential tools in the mining and aggregate sectors, designed to reduce rock size by crushing material between a moving mantle and a fixed liner. The market is primarily driven by the surging demand for crushed stone in infrastructure projects and the growing need for metallic minerals resulting from global urbanization. This intense demand for raw material processing is supported by industrial output data; the World Steel Association reported that global crude steel production hit 1,882.6 million tonnes in 2024, highlighting the ongoing requirement for heavy-duty iron ore processing machinery.

Nevertheless, the market faces a significant obstacle due to the high operational and maintenance costs linked to this equipment. The extreme pressure and friction necessary to crush hard, abrasive materials lead to the rapid wear of key components, which demands frequent, expensive replacements and causes operational delays. This financial strain can discourage cost-conscious operators from making investments, acting as a major barrier to the widespread adoption of capital-intensive crushing machinery in emerging markets.
Market Driver
The growth of mining operations and mineral exploration acts as a major catalyst for the cone crusher market, fuelled by the rising demand for critical minerals such as copper and lithium. Cone crushers are vital to the comminution process, effectively breaking down hard ore during secondary and tertiary stages to liberate valuable minerals for subsequent processing. This demand is underscored by increased capital spending on extraction; the International Energy Agency's 'Global Critical Minerals Outlook 2024', published in May 2024, noted that investment in critical minerals mining rose by 10% in 2023, requiring robust crushing fleets. Deploying these machines allows mining operators to sustain the high throughput rates needed to meet the supply demands of the energy transition.
Additionally, increasing government spending on global infrastructure projects significantly boosts the adoption of cone crushers, as these initiatives require massive amounts of various construction aggregates. Large-scale projects, including highways, bridges, and urban developments, depend on these machines to produce high-quality, cubical stone aggregates that adhere to strict engineering standards. For example, the Ministry of Finance in India announced in its February 2024 'Interim Budget 2024-2025' that the capital expenditure for infrastructure was raised by 11.1% to ₹11,11,111 crore, signaling a sharp rise in material needs. To satisfy this construction demand, producers are scaling up output; the U.S. Geological Survey estimated that 2023 U.S. crushed stone production reached 1.5 billion tons, emphasizing the critical role of heavy crushing equipment in the supply chain.
Market Challenge
Substantial operational and maintenance expenses present a major hurdle to the growth of the global cone crusher market. These machines operate by applying immense compression forces to break down abrasive materials, a process that inherently causes rapid wear on vital components such as mantles and concave liners. Consequently, operators face a recurring need to replace parts, which incurs direct equipment costs and necessitates frequent production stoppages. This downtime interrupts revenue generation, causing the total cost of ownership to be significantly higher than the initial purchase price implies.
This financial pressure is intensified by the massive volume of material that must be processed in the mining and aggregate sectors. According to the U.S. Geological Survey, total crushed stone production in the United States reached 1.5 billion tons in 2023. Handling such vast quantities increases the frequency of maintenance intervals, thereby reducing profit margins for mining and aggregate companies. For smaller enterprises or projects in price-sensitive regions, these cumulative operating costs can make the adoption of capital-intensive cone crushing technology financially unfeasible, effectively limiting market penetration in cost-conscious economies.
Market Trends
A significant trend in the industry is the adoption of Hybrid and Electric-Powered Drive Systems, as operators increasingly prioritize decarbonization and operational efficiency over traditional diesel-only models. This shift is motivated by the need to lower fuel logistics costs and adhere to stricter emission standards in mining and urban settings, prompting manufacturers to create equipment that can toggle seamlessly between mains power and onboard generators. The market appeal of these sustainable solutions is clear from recent financial results; Metso Corporation's 'Annual Report 2023', released in March 2024, reported that sales of their energy-efficient 'Planet Positive' portfolio grew by 18% year-on-year, reflecting a strong industry move toward electrified crushing equipment.
Simultaneously, there is rising utilization of crushers in Construction and Demolition Waste Recycling, shifting demand patterns away from solely primary aggregate production. This trend is driven by circular economy mandates and urban planning regulations that require contractors to process concrete and asphalt debris on-site for reuse rather than sending it to landfills. The sheer volume of material available for reprocessing highlights the need for specialized fleets; the European Climate, Infrastructure and Environment Executive Agency noted in October 2024 that construction and demolition activities now generate 40% of all waste in the European Union, creating a critical imperative for the deployment of crushers capable of secondary material recovery.
